Effects of individual and combined stresses of Salinity (NaCl) and Heavy metal (NiCl2) Levels on Seed Germination and seedlings of Citrullus colocynthis L.

Hassan Raza Javeed
Abstract


ABSTRACT Salinity and heavy metal stresses are great hindrance for germination and early development of plants. Nickel (Ni) is an indispensible micronutrient for plants at low and toxic in high concentration. However the proficiency depends upon the plants types. Citrullus colocynth is medicinal salt and heavy metal tolerant cucurbit weed. The contemporary target of study is to appraise the influence of single and combined stresses by varying concentrations of sodium chloride and nickel chloride on germination and seedlings of C. colocynth. Germination percentage, radicle length, plumule length, fresh weight and dry weight of seedlings of C. colocynth with three levels of salt (100mM, 200mM and 400mMNaCl), three levels of heavy metal (50, 100, 200uMNiCl2) and Nine combined levels(100mMNaCl +50uM NiCl2), (200mMNaCl +50 uMNiCl2) (400mMNaCl +50uM NiCl2) (100mMNaCl +100uMNiCl2) (200mM NaCl +100uM NiCl2) (400mMNaCl +100uMNiCl2) (100mMNaCl +200uMNiCl2) (200mMNaCl +200 uMNiCl2) (400mMNaCl +200uMNiCl2) were studied. This experiment was conceded out in completely randomized design with four replications. Statistical analysis was performed using 8.1 of STATISTIX software using ANOVA and LSD. The responses to different levels of salinity, heavy metal and combined stresses in all measured traits showed adverse trend with increasing stress levels. This species has suitable germination at 100mMNaCl, 50uM NiCl2 and combined (100mMNaCl +50 uMNiCl2), endure at 200mMNaCl, 100 uMNiCl2, (200mMNaCl +50uMNiCl2), (100mM NaCl +100 uMNiCl2) and (200mM NaCl +100 uM NiCl2). Germination and seedling growth factors declined under high stress levels of salt (400mM NaCl), high heavy metal (100 uM NiCl2) and combined high salt or high heavy metal with any other levels of salt or heavy metal.
